So I’d like to introduce anyone that gives a crap to my other latest fun thing to follow, the YouTube Premium show called Cobra Kai. For anyone that doesn’t know what that is, basically, it’s the continued story of Johnny Lawrence (the badass blonde bully in The Karate Kid) and Daniel (well, if you don’t know who Daniel is, you might need to do a little bit of catching up fam). The catch is it’s picking up on their lives 34 years after the original movie was released! So go watch The Karate Kid – THE ONLY Karate Kid movie that really matters is the original 1984 film starring Pat Morita, Ralph Macchio and William Zabka.
